Is Fort Worth or Miami better for remote workers?

For remote workers, Fort Worth edges ahead based on overall cost of living, internet costs, and taxes. The no-state-income-tax advantage in Fort Worth is particularly valuable for remote workers with high salaries. The best choice depends on your priorities โ€” cost vs walkability vs community.

How much money can I save working remotely in Fort Worth vs staying in San Francisco?

If you earn $120K remotely and relocate from San Francisco (COL index 194) to Fort Worth (COL index 91), you'd save approximately $5,309/month on equivalent purchasing power โ€” or about $63,708/year. This doesn't account for potential salary adjustments.

What is internet service like in Fort Worth vs Miami?

Median monthly internet costs are $68 in Fort Worth and $70 in Miami. Both cities have competitive broadband options suitable for remote work, including gigabit fiber in most areas.

Can I negotiate a remote salary if I move from a high-cost city to Fort Worth or Miami?

Many employers now use location-based pay. Moving from a top-tier city to Fort Worth could trigger a salary adjustment. Even at 85% of a $150K SF salary ($127.5K), the lower COL in Fort Worth or Miami typically means significantly higher purchasing power and take-home after local taxes.

Which city has better walkability for remote workers who don't need to commute?

Miami has a higher walk score (78 vs 28), meaning more errands, coffee shops, and restaurants are reachable on foot โ€” a big quality-of-life factor when you're home all day. Walk scores above 70 are considered "very walkable."
